问题标签 [jfreereport]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
java - 如何在 Jfree PieChart 中设置自定义工具提示标签?
在我JfreeChart
的 中,标签格式是{0}, {1}, {2}
.
这里{0}
代表饼图section key,{1}
代表section value,{2}
代表百分比。
我正在使用以下代码在饼图中设置标签
让我们假设图表有 2 个部分。value({1})
第一段是200,第二段是150。我的要求是这样的:
谁能告诉如何修改这个值?
jasper-reports - 在使用 BarChart 的情况下出现定制器类错误:BarRenderer cannot be cast to net.sf.jasperreports.engine.JRChartCustomizer
我正在尝试使用jFree图表中的自定义程序类BarRenderer来自定义条形图,我已将 jar 添加到类路径中,并将该类添加到条形图属性的自定义程序类部分中,为org.jfree.chart.renderer.category .BarRenderer我不断收到错误消息:
有什么我错过或忘记在这里做的事情吗,任何帮助让它运行将不胜感激
java - 根据值更改图表点颜色 - JFreeChart
我有一个 CSV 文件,看起来像这样(文件可以在这里下载)
我想用 X 轴上的时间(电子表格中的第一列)和 Y 轴上的开关名称(除第一列之外的所有列标题)来绘制它。我希望为每一列在 Y 轴上创建一个点。该列将与 X 轴水平,但颜色应根据值 TRUE 或 FALSE 或 0、1、2 更改。
这是我到目前为止开发的:
当它运行时,它会生成如下所示的内容:
我想在 csv 文件中列中的值发生变化时更改点的颜色(不管颜色是什么,这是我们在查看时想要看到的颜色变化)。如果这是不可能的,那么为每个节点设置值的方法就足够了(具有悬停效果)。
java - Writing J Free chart with Chinese label to pdf
我正在尝试编写带有中文标签的 JFree 图表 To PDf,我可以在没有标签的情况下看到 pdf 中的图表。但我需要带有标签的图表。
下面是代码片段。有人可以帮忙吗?
预期输出:带有中文标签的图表